Pandemonium broke out Friday at the Orile side of Second Rainbow along the Oshodi-Apapa Expressway as a trigger-happy policeman killed a commercial bus driver.
According to an eyewitness report, the policeman whose identityis yet to be ascertained, shot the bus driver for refusing to drop the daily amount they usually give policemen, as they (commercial bus drivers) ply that route.
This is coming barely a month after a police Corporal, Museliu Aremu, shot at a tricyclist, Sunday Ebong and killed his wife, Comfort Idongiset at the Ijegun area of the state for refusing to part with N100 bribe.
It was gathered that the policeman, attached to Orile Police Station, had attempted to shoot the tyre of the bus as the driver made to escape, but the shot killed the driver instead.
THISDAY gathered that the bullet hit the driver on his chest, killing him instantly, while his conductor escaped unhurt.
Expectedly, this infuriated other bus drivers and they staged a protest, forcing the policemen to flee to their station to reinforce.
However, the rampaging bus drivers were having none of that, thus forcing the policemen to shoot into the air to disperse the crowd.
Other commuters who witnessed the sporadic gunshots took to social media to warn potential road users to keep off the route.
All efforts to get the command's spokesman, DSP Joseph Offor, reaction proved abortive as he did not respond to calls to his phone.
